# AI Podcast Ops

**One podcast episode in, 15-20 content pieces out. Scored, deduplicated, and scheduled.**

Most podcast teams publish an episode and maybe pull one audiogram. This pipeline treats every episode as a content mine — extracting narrative arcs, quotable moments, controversial takes, data points, and stories, then generating platform-native content for every channel with viral scoring and deduplication.

### 🎙️ Podcast-to-Everything Pipeline (`podcast_pipeline.py`)
End-to-end pipeline that ingests podcast episodes (via RSS feed or raw transcript) and produces a full cross-platform content calendar.

**Ingest modes:**
- RSS feed → auto-download + Whisper transcription
- Raw transcript file (text, SRT, VTT)
- Batch mode: process last N episodes from a feed

**Content generated per episode:**
- 3-5 short-form video clip suggestions (with timestamps + hooks)
- 2-3 Twitter/X thread outlines
- 1 LinkedIn article draft
- 1 newsletter section
- 3-5 quote cards (text overlays for social)
- 1 blog post outline with SEO keywords
- 1 YouTube Shorts/TikTok script

**Intelligence layer:**
- Editorial Brain: LLM-powered extraction of 7 content atom types
- Viral scoring: Novelty × Controversy × Utility (0-100)
- Dedup engine: semantic similarity check against last N days of output
- Calendar generator: auto-schedules by platform best practices

## How It Works

```
RSS Feed / Transcript
        │
        ▼
┌─────────────────┐
│  1. INGEST       │  Download audio → Whisper → clean transcript
│                  │  OR read transcript file directly
└────────┬────────┘
         │
         ▼
┌─────────────────┐
│  2. EXTRACT      │  Editorial Brain: find narrative arcs, quotes,
│                  │  controversial takes, data points, stories,
│                  │  frameworks, predictions
└────────┬────────┘
         │
         ▼
┌─────────────────┐
│  3. GENERATE     │  For each atom → platform-native content:
│                  │  clips, threads, articles, newsletter,
│                  │  quote cards, blog outlines, short scripts
└────────┬────────┘
         │
         ▼
┌─────────────────┐
│  4. SCORE        │  Viral potential: novelty × controversy × utility
│                  │  Filter below threshold
└────────┬────────┘
         │
         ▼
┌─────────────────┐
│  5. DEDUP        │  Semantic similarity vs last N days
│                  │  Remove overlaps, flag near-dupes
└────────┬────────┘
         │
         ▼
┌─────────────────┐
│  6. SCHEDULE     │  Calendar generation with platform-specific
│                  │  timing rules and content mix optimization
└─────────────────┘
```

## Viral Scoring

Every generated piece is scored on three dimensions:

| Dimension | Weight | What It Measures |
|-----------|--------|-----------------|
| Novelty | 40% | Is this new or surprising? |
| Controversy | 30% | Will people argue about this? |
| Utility | 30% | Can someone use this immediately? |

**Thresholds:** 80+ = priority publish, 60-79 = solid fill, 40-59 = gap filler, <40 = cut
